Despite these significant drawbacks, the collection does offer modern amenities. The inclusion of online play, enhanced by rollback netcode, is a critical feature for any modern fighting game collection. Rollback netcode is engineered to provide a smoother, more responsive online experience by predicting opponent inputs, significantly reducing lag compared to older netcode implementations. In our assessment, this feature alone elevates the collection beyond a mere archival release, allowing players to engage competitively despite geographical challenges. 5What is rollback netcode and why is it important for this game?

Rollback netcode is a modern networking technology for online gaming that significantly reduces perceived latency by predicting opponent inputs. It ensures a much smoother and more responsive online fighting experience, which is crucial for competitive play in games like Mortal Kombat.
